NetApp Certified Implementation Engineer – Data Protection — Question 15
You have a new ONTAP 9.7 2-node AFF A300 cluster with 2x DS224C full shelves of 3.8 TB encrypted SSDs.
In this scenario, which statement matches the factory disk-ownership setting? (Choose the best answer.)
Answer options
- A. All drives on shelf 1 are assigned to one node, and all drives on shelf 2 are assigned to the partner node.
- B. All even-numbered drives on each shelf are assigned to one node, and all odd-numbered drives on each shelf are assigned to the partner node.
- C. Disk ownership is not assigned by the factory.
- D. Drives 0-11 on each shelf are assigned to one node, and drives 12-23 on each shelf are assigned to the partner node.
Correct answer: C
Explanation
The correct answer is C because factory settings for disk ownership in ONTAP do not assign ownership to specific nodes, leaving that configuration up to the administrator. Options A, B, and D incorrectly specify a predefined ownership assignment, which is not the case in this scenario.
